In the early 20th century, Danish astrophysicist Ejnar Hertzsprung and American astrophysicist Henry Norris Russell independently developed a graph now known as the Hertzsprung-Russell (H-R) diagram, which plots absolute brightness against spectral type. In this diagram, the brightest stars lie near the top of the diagram and the hottest stars lie to the left. On the H-R diagram, most of the stars, including the Sun, fall along a diagonal line that goes from the upper left to the lower right of the diagram. This line called the main sequence.The great majority of stars neighboring the Sun fall on the lower part of the H-R diagram's main sequence, and relatively few lie on the portion of the main sequence above the Sun. This means that most of the Sun's neighboring stars are both cooler and fainter (in absolute magnitude) than the Sun. A smaller population of brighter but cooler stars known as supergiants occupies the uppermost region of the diagram. Some stars, which are difficult to discover because they are so intrinsically faint, lie near the bottom of the H-R diagram. These faint stars are called white dwarfs.

when was the H and R diagram created and how?

The Hertzsprung-Russell diagram, or H-R diagram, was created in 1911 by Ejnar Hertzsprung and Henry Norris Russell. They plotted the luminosity of stars against their surface temperature to classify and study stellar populations. This diagram revolutionized our understanding of stars and their life cycles.
